High Valyrian

Etymology

From u- +‎ pyghagon.

Pronunciation

(Classical) IPA(key): /upyˈɣaɡon/

Rhymes: -aɡon

Verb

upyghagon (vowel-final, perfect participle upȳda)

  1. to elude, to get away from someone (dative)
